Abstract:This study screened and determined nine representative malodorous compounds in view of the complexity of malodorous substances faced by adult diapers in actual use. Through a comparative test study comprehensively using the detection tube method, liquid chromatography-mass spectrometry, and thermal desorption-gas chromatography-mass spectrometry, a scientific detection system for the deodorization effectiveness of adult diapers was established, and the deodorization effectiveness of different brands of adult diapers on the market were evaluated. The results showed that some samples had deodorization effectiveness of more than 98% on compounds such as isovaleric acid, 2-nonenal, and indole. The deodorant adult diapers added with antibacterial raw materials usually had deodorization effectiveness on ammonia of more than 70%, which was significantly better than the deodorization effectiveness of ordinary diapers (less than 30%). However, the deodorization effectiveness on compounds such as methanethiol still needed to be improved.
